History of the Pekingese Chihuahua Mix

The origins of the Pekingese Chihuahua mix dog can be traced back to the early 2000s. As the demand for companion dogs with unique traits grew, breeders began crossing different breeds to create hybrids that combined the best features of each parent. The Pekingese Chihuahua mix was one such hybrid, inheriting the elegant appearance of the Pekingese and the spirited nature of the Chihuahua.

Physical Characteristics

Size and Appearance

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es typically weigh between 4 and 12 pounds and stand at a height of 8 to 12 inches. Their bodies are sturdy and compact, resembling that of their Chihuahua parent. The head is slightly domed and broad, with large expressive eyes that reflect their Pekingese heritage. The ears are typically erect and V-shaped, adding to their alert and curious expression.

Coat and Color

The coat of a Pekingese Chihuahua mix can vary depending on the genetic makeup of the individual dog. Some may inherit the long, flowing coat of the Pekingese, while others may have the shorter, single-layered coat of the Chihuahua. Common coat colors include black, white, brown, tan, and a combination of these.

Personality and Temperament

Affection and Loyalty

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es are renowned for their affectionate and loyal nature. They form strong bonds with their owners and become devoted companions. They enjoy spending time with their family, showering them with love and affection.

Intelligence and Trainability

These hybrids are intelligent dogs that are eager to please. They respond well to positive reinforcement training methods and can learn commands and tricks easily. However, their independent streak may occasionally surface, requiring patience and consistency in training.

Activity Level and Exercise Needs

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es have moderate energy levels. They enjoy short bursts of activity, such as playing fetch or going for walks, but are not as high-energy as some other breeds. Daily exercise is essential to keep them mentally and physically stimulated.

Care and Maintenance

Grooming

The grooming needs of a Pekingese Chihuahua mix will depend on the type of coat they inherit. Dogs with long coats will require regular brushing to prevent mats and tangles. Baths should be given as needed to keep their coats clean and healthy.

Diet

A balanced diet is crucial for the health and well-being of a Pekingese Chihuahua mix. Consult with your veterinarian to determine the appropriate diet for your dog's age, activity level, and health condition.

Health and Lifespan

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es are generally healthy dogs with a lifespan of 10 to 15 years. However, like all breeds, they may be prone to certain health conditions. Regular veterinary check-ups and preventive care are essential to ensure their overall well-being.

FAQ About Pekingese Chihuahua Mix Dog

1. What is a Pekingese Chihuahua mix dog?

A Pekingese Chihuahua mix dog is a cross between a Pekingese and a Chihuahua.

2. What do Pekingese Chihuahua mix dogs look like?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es can vary in appearance, but they typically have a small to medium-sized body, a long and silky coat, and a short muzzle.

3. What is the personality of a Pekingese Chihuahua mix dog?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es are typically friendly, playful, and affectionate dogs. They are also known for being very loyal and protective of their owners.

4. How do you care for a Pekingese Chihuahua mix dog?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es are relatively low-maintenance dogs. They require regular grooming to keep their coat healthy, and they should be taken for regular walks or runs to stay active.

5. What are the common health problems of Pekingese Chihuahua mix dogs?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es are generally healthy dogs, but they can be prone to certain health problems, such as patellar luxation, eye problems, and hip dysplasia.

6. How long do Pekingese Chihuahua mix dogs live?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es typically live for 12 to 15 years.

7. Are Pekingese Chihuahua mix dogs good with children?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es can be good with children, but it is important to supervise interactions between young children and dogs.

8. Are Pekingese Chihuahua mix dogs good with other pets?

Pekingese Chihuahua mixes can be good with other pets, but it is important to introduce them slowly and carefully.
